Over this past week, there has been this theme of patterns of things in mind body healing or transformation that feel good, but can keep you stuck or even backfire at a deeper level. And today there’s an additional one that came up with my beautiful volunteer, and it’s this. It’s that so often people want so badly to change the people that they love because they care.
You know, it’s this feeling of as you’re waking up to more and more and more self-awareness and more self-healing and the power of the mind, of course, when you care about people you love, you want them to reap the rewards. You want them to have an incredible life. And so it can feel hard not to say something.
But imagine for a moment if you felt like in your life, you know, somebody you love is following you around, trying to change you, trying to change you based on their beliefs. What happens? Well, likely you’d run. Likely you want to get away from them. And unfortunately, I see that over and over again where somebody is…
who has a, a beautiful heart, who is waking up to the awareness of the power of the mind and what we’re capable of, and then unfortunately the way that it ends up coming out to people around them is a feeling of trying to control them or change them, and it can show up as frustration or hurt. And this was one of the key patterns was exactly this, is that, uh, it’s just the feeling of wanting, you know, from a genuine place to fix somebody.
And so, so often that- that’s what’s confusing. That’s what can feel challenging is because it comes from a place of love. It comes from a place of care. It comes from a place of doing good. But on the receiving end How would it feel to you in your life? Like, if somebody’s trying to control you based on their beliefs, and they’re trying to control you, and change you, and change you, and fix you, and fix you, and fix you, and fix you, and tell you what to do, and change you.
It doesn’t feel good. And so of course, if that’s the situation, instead it’s, you know, having somebody else become excited about it, giving them a, a book or a video, or, “Oh my gosh, I just saw this. This is amazing,” or, or a podcast or whatever it is. But getting them… ’cause excited about it. Because when they’re excited about it, they want to change themselves.
And if they’re not excited about it, then you wouldn’t want to force them, and instead you just want to love them for them. And that is the insight that I really want to share today is exactly that, is thinking about your relationships and noticing, are you wanting to change people? Are you wanting to fix people?
Because on the, on the other side, so often I see people who have the sweetest hearts, who are just so kind, who are so caring, and feel so rejected and so lonely and disconnected because they’re doing that very thing. They are trying to fix everybody around them. And as- And it’s not… It’s unsolicited fixing, which is controlling.
So it ends up feeling like everybody around them doesn’t want to be around them or avoids them, and then they have all of this hurt. And so food for thought, because I see it so often. I’ve seen it from mothers who are wanting to fix their grown children, and eventually their grown children are, like, avoiding their mom.
And there’s been so much hurt. Or friends or family or a wife to a husband or vice versa. It just, all of the time. And so food for thought. It, it may seem like a, a small shift, but it’s really profound and big if you action it. Creating that feeling of love, creating that feeling of connection, loving somebody just the way they are, even if you can’t fix them, that, and having fun and creating love, that is, in many cases, that can be part of the fix in and of itself, is just having that fun, having that connection.
